Transaction 51fe14d63c94990d211e47976bbd607a7a4a860e7ab90b993a602b40a48ecda6

2 Input
2 Outputs
  • 51fe14d63c94990d211e47976bbd607a7a4a860e7ab90b993a602b40a48ecda6:0
  • value  10186366
    address  1J9ytzwssFW52fiFQdsUi7CRtC2H8vVZJz
  • 51fe14d63c94990d211e47976bbd607a7a4a860e7ab90b993a602b40a48ecda6:1
  • value  74540022
    address  1B1XndmHLy2qGoL4HGN2bwzo6qBpmSVXTy